A diversified portfolio including Illumination (Despicable Me, Super Mario Bros.), DreamWorks Animation, and live-action franchises ( Fast & Furious, Jurassic World ). It also owns the successful horror label Blumhouse Productions ( The Purge, Get Out, Five Nights at Freddy's ). In the modern age of streaming wars and
